Understanding the Components
To fully appreciate the stunning features of an RC train set, it’s essential to understand the main components involved.
The Train Engine
At the heart of any train set is the engine, which can come in various styles and scales. Battery-operated, electric, or even live steam locomotives offer different experiences for operating the train, and choosing the right one can drastically affect the overall operation and enjoyment. Realistic detailing in both appearance and performance—or a combination of both—can enhance the overall authenticity of the setup.
The Track System
The track system is just as crucial, providing the foundation for the entire layout. Hobbyists can select from flexible track designs that allow for custom track configurations to more rigid systems that emphasize realism and stability. Innovative features like interlocking tracks make it easier to create complex routes, while magnetic components can add an extra element of interest.
Digital Enhancements for Modern Train Sets
The advancement of technology has transformed the world of model trains. Many stunning RC train sets incorporate digital control systems, allowing for more refined operations. Digital command control (DCC) enables users to independently control multiple locomotives on the same track, allowing for intricate setups similar to real railroad systems. Features like sound effects and realistic lighting make the experience even more exciting.

Choosing the Right RC Train Set
To choose a stunning RC train set that fits your needs, consider several important factors:
1. Scale and Size: Different scales, such as O, HO, or N, offer various levels of detail and space requirements. Choose a scale that fits well within your available space and personal preference.
2. Budget Concerns: While it’s easy to get carried away, establishing a budget before diving into purchases can help prevent overspending and ensure you get the best set for your investment.
3. Purpose of Use: Identify whether you intend to use the train set for display purposes, operational enjoyment, or both. This will guide your purchasing decisions regarding engines, tracks, and scenery.
